Abstract
The present invention provides a system and method for controlling at least one lighting system by means of a portable wireless remote control device. The system comprises a portable wireless remote control device, a lighting system controller, and at least one lighting system coupled to the lighting system controller. Each lighting system comprises one or more lighting modules (e.g., light emitting diodes (LEDs), incandescent bulbs, etc.). The portable wireless remote control device comprises a wireless transceiver, processor, memory, light control logic, user interface (UI), and an antenna. The lighting system controller-comprises a wireless transceiver, processor, memory, light control logic, and an antenna. Each lighting system coupled (e.g., wired) to the lighting system controller may be wirelessly controlled via the remote control device.
